This annual forum brings together professionals in academia and industry who are engaged in engineering education initiatives to share information on effective models, experiences, and best practices.
Topic: The Community-Engaged College: Grand Valley State University's Industry and Community Partnership Model.
Speaker: Dr. Paul Plotkowski, Dean of the Padnos College of Engineering and Computing.
